As I awoke this morning I consulted with an app on my Kindle, Mark Nepo’s The Book of Awakening.   This has become my habit on leisurely mornings.  Today I was looking for a quote that was mentioned at Yoga on Wednesday.  Instead I found a different entry, a story about a troubled man who in his frustration and confusion finally turned to seek guidance from a sage.

The sage listened to the man and looked deeply into his eyes with great compassion.  He offered the man a choice.  He could either have a map or a boat.  The man looking at the other  confused and troubled pilgrims around him chose the boat.  The sage, kissing him on the forehead said, “Go then.  You are the boat.  Life is the sea.”

Indeed, we are the boat on the sea of life.  Everything that we need, we already have.  We connect with our life course through our breath.   Our breath takes us out to sea.  Our ability to listen inside and connect to our breath is our map.

I didn’t find the quote I was looking for, but I found the passage that I needed for today; a lovely reminder that as the new year approaches I have everything that I need.  I am complete on the sea of life.
